- ;;; Commentary:
-
- ;;;; Terminals that use XON/XOFF flow control can cause problems with
- ;;;; GNU Emacs users. This file contains Emacs Lisp code that makes it
- ;;;; easy for a user to deal with this problem, when using such a
- ;;;; terminal.
- ;;;;
- ;;;; To invoke these adjustments, a user need only invoke the function
- ;;;; enable-flow-control-on with a list of terminal types in his/her own
- ;;;; .emacs file. As arguments, give it the names of one or more terminal
- ;;;; types in use by that user which require flow control adjustments.
- ;;;; Here's an example:
- ;;;;
- ;;;; (enable-flow-control-on "vt200" "vt300" "vt101" "vt131")
-
- ;;; Portability note: This uses (getenv "TERM"), and therefore probably
- ;;; won't work outside of UNIX-like environments.

- (defvar flow-control-c-s-replacement ?\034
- "Character that replaces C-s, when flow control handling is enabled.")
- (defvar flow-control-c-q-replacement ?\036
- "Character that replaces C-q, when flow control handling is enabled.")
-
- ;;;###autoload
- (defun enable-flow-control (&optional argument)
- "Toggle flow control handling.
- When handling is enabled, user can type C-s as C-\\, and C-q as C-^.
- With arg, enable flow control mode if arg is positive, otherwise disable."
- (interactive "P")
- (if (if argument
- ;; Argument means enable if arg is positive.
- (<= (prefix-numeric-value argument) 0)
- ;; No arg means toggle.
- (nth 1 (current-input-mode)))
- (progn
- ;; Turn flow control off, and stop exchanging chars.
- (set-input-mode t nil (nth 2 (current-input-mode)))
- (if keyboard-translate-table
- (progn
- (aset keyboard-translate-table flow-control-c-s-replacement
- flow-control-c-s-replacement)
- (aset keyboard-translate-table ?\^s ?\^s)
- (aset keyboard-translate-table flow-control-c-q-replacement
- flow-control-c-q-replacement)
- (aset keyboard-translate-table ?\^q ?\^q))))
- ;; Turn flow control on.
- ;; Tell emacs to pass C-s and C-q to OS.
- (set-input-mode nil t (nth 2 (current-input-mode)))
- ;; Initialize translate table, saving previous mappings, if any.
- (let ((the-table (make-string 128 0)))
- (let ((i 0)
- (j (length keyboard-translate-table)))
- (while (< i j)
- (aset the-table i (elt keyboard-translate-table i))
- (setq i (1+ i)))
- (while (< i 128)
- (aset the-table i i)
- (setq i (1+ i))))
- (setq keyboard-translate-table the-table))
- ;; Swap C-s and C-\
- (aset keyboard-translate-table flow-control-c-s-replacement ?\^s)
- (aset keyboard-translate-table ?\^s flow-control-c-s-replacement)
- ;; Swap C-q and C-^
- (aset keyboard-translate-table flow-control-c-q-replacement ?\^q)
- (aset keyboard-translate-table ?\^q flow-control-c-q-replacement)
- (message (concat
- "XON/XOFF adjustment for "
- (getenv "TERM")
- ": use C-\\ for C-s and use C-^ for C-q."))
- (sleep-for 2))) ; Give user a chance to see message.
-
- ;;;###autoload
- (defun enable-flow-control-on (&rest losing-terminal-types)
- "Enable flow control if using one of a specified set of terminal types.
- Use `(enable-flow-control-on \"vt100\" \"h19\")' to enable flow control
- on VT-100 and H19 terminals. When flow control is enabled,
- you must type C-\\ to get the effect of a C-s, and type C-^
- to get the effect of a C-q."
- (let ((term (getenv "TERM"))
- hyphend)
- (if term
- (progn
- ;; Strip off hyphen and what follows
- (while (setq hyphend (string-match "[-_][^-_]+$" term))
- (setq term (substring term 0 hyphend)))
- (and (member term losing-terminal-types)
- (enable-flow-control))))))
-
- (provide 'flow-ctrl)
